Product Overview: TPS73133DBVRG4 from Texas Instruments
The TPS73133DBVRG4 is a high-performance, low-dropout linear regulator (LDO) from Texas Instruments, renowned for its reliability and efficiency in a wide range of applications. This LDO is designed to deliver a fixed output voltage of 3.3V with an input voltage range from 2.7V to 5.5V, making it suitable for battery-powered devices and other portable applications.
With an impressive dropout voltage of just 250mV at a 150mA load, the TPS73133DBVRG4 ensures a stable voltage supply even when the input voltage is close to the output voltage. This characteristic is particularly important for maintaining consistent performance as battery voltages decline over time.
One of the key features of the TPS73133DBVRG4 is its low quiescent current, which is typically 50µA. This makes it an excellent choice for power-sensitive applications, as it helps to extend battery life by minimizing power consumption when the device is in standby mode. The LDO also provides an impressive transient response, quickly adapting to changes in load, which is crucial for maintaining voltage stability during rapid power demands.
For enhanced system reliability, the TPS73133DBVRG4 incorporates several protective features. It includes thermal shutdown and overcurrent protection, ensuring that the device and the system it powers are safeguarded against conditions that could lead to damage or failure. Additionally, the LDO has a low noise output, which is essential for sensitive RF and analog circuits that require a clean power supply.
The TPS73133DBVRG4 comes in a compact SOT-23-5 package, which is ideal for space-constrained applications. Its small footprint allows for efficient use of PCB space, which is a significant advantage in portable electronics where every millimeter counts.
